Social Media is Your Shop Window
In many ways, social media has become your digital shop window. It’s where potential funders, partners, volunteers and the public go to see what you’re doing and what you stand for. If your social media presence is outdated or inactive, it might give the impression that your organisation is no longer active; even if you're doing fantastic work behind the scenes.
It Builds Trust and Tells Your Story
Social media allows you to share real stories, in real time. That might mean highlighting the impact of a recent project, celebrating a volunteer, or responding quickly to events in your community. When people see your authenticity and values reflected consistently online, they’re more likely to trust and support you.
